==== Report for week of 7/9 ====
 * We cleaned up after the heavy rain. There was no significant damage but some cardboard boxes of parts got wet and the contents needed to be moved to other containers and the boxes discarded. Water collected on the SR2 crane slot cover and had to be vacuumed away before the cover could be opened. A new section of corrugated roof was installed to minimize the problem for the future.
 * Enzo and team got all of the in-vacuum and in-air cables for the SF/... and PI properly routed and tested except (so far) for the geophones.
 * Hirata-san and team finished tuning of the F0 for SR2 and moved the PI into the SR2 cleanbooth. It turns out to be about 8 kg weaker than for SR3, whereas the SR2 chain is only 3 kg lighter, so we will have to do some combination of decompression, removing Cu segments and using a stronger CuBe spring (e.g., a Type A F0 FR blade instead of the F2 one in SR3). We closed the floor in the SRM area for safety, but we will probably reopen it as soon as next week for the SRM F0 build.
 * Hirata-san opened the SR3 tank, craned the LBB damper ring sandwich up to the top of the tank and suspended it.
 * Enzo and team corrected a lot of flipped connections on the SR3 PI LVDTs (primary<->secondary on the horizontal, primary<->actuation on the F0).
 * We added the arc weights and geophones and re-centered the IP. It seems stable and very soft, which is good.
==== Report for the week of 3/4 ====
 * On Monday, Mark helped Aso-san with PR3, and Monday, Tuesday and Wednesday, Fabian helped Fujii-kun with PRM.
 * Mark and Terrence attempted to offload some BS IM/IRM yaw adjustments that had been done by Enomoto-san last Friday. They rezeroed the OL and then opened the tank lid and did a compensating adjustment to the F0 yaw stepper, then undid the IM/IRM yaw with the pico. However this did not have the desired effect, probably because the buoyancy correction had not been cancelled when Enomoto-san was working and the BF keystone was very high, with the IM-V OSEMs way too far in and possibly touching. We did our best to back out all the adjustments but the roll TFs were still messy and there were signs that the IM was not free in yaw (the IM/IRM Y varied oppositely to IP Y, indicating that the IMR was free and the IM wasn't). We ended up deciding to have Mirapro remove the ducts on the ±X sides of the tank so we could go in and inspect.
 * Terrence tuned the SR3 LEN OL to be free of yaw cross-coupling.
 * Terrence and Enzo did a full set of filters and a Guardian for SR2 and SR3.
 * Terrence did health checks on SR2 and SR3.
 * Enzo measured mode Qs.
